    Foundation Overview

    Mission

    The Kirkpatrick Foundation mission is to support arts, culture, education, animal wellbeing, environmental conservation, and historic preservation, primarily in Central Oklahoma. The vision is to make Oklahoma the safest and most humane place to be an animal by the year 2032.

    How to Apply

    Two-stage process starting with Letter of Inquiry (LOI), followed by second-stage application if LOI accepted. New grantee portal starting June 1, 2025. Contact Susan Grossman at 405.608.0937.

    Does Not Fund

    Do not fund organizations that advocate for or are involved in the killing, abuse, or harm of animals; limited to one request per year; must serve Central Oklahoma
